Understanding the Mechanics: What Sets Free Bet Blackjack Apart

Free Bet Blackjack, a derivative of traditional blackjack, introduces a unique twist: the casino offers free bets on certain split and double-down hands. This feature significantly alters the game’s strategic landscape and player expectations. Specifically, when a player has a hard total of 9, 10, or 11, or when they split a pair (excluding split Aces), the casino provides a free bet. This effectively reduces the player’s risk and increases their potential returns, leading to a higher return-to-player (RTP) percentage compared to standard blackjack variants. This is a crucial factor in attracting players, as it offers a perceived advantage and a more engaging gameplay experience. The rules typically involve the dealer standing on soft 17 and the player having the option to double down on any two cards. Understanding these specific rule variations is paramount for accurately assessing the game’s profitability and player appeal.
